Maun is a city located in Botswana, Africa, at the coordinates -19.98333, 23.41667. It serves as the administrative and tourism hub of the Ngamiland District and is situated on the banks of the Thamalakane River. The city is renowned as the gateway to the Okavango Delta,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and one of the world’s largest inland deltas.

This unique ecosystem attracts numerous tourists for safaris, birdwatching, and cultural experiences with local communities. Maun operates within the Africa/Gaborone timezone, aligning with the Central Africa Time (CAT). The city’s regional significance is underscored by its role as a starting point for many adventures into the delta and surrounding wildlife reserves, making it a crucial area for Botswana’s tourism industry.

Timezone in Maun

Maun is located in the Africa/Gaborone timezone, which has a UTC offset of +2 hours. This means that Maun operates two hours ahead of Coordinated Universal Time. Notably, there is no daylight saving time observed in Maun, so the time remains consistent throughout the year without any seasonal changes.

When comparing the time in Maun to various locations in the United States, there can be significant differences. For instance, Eastern Standard Time is UTC-5, making Maun seven hours ahead during standard time. This can be a challenge for scheduling calls or meetings.

The best time to contact someone in Maun would typically be between 9 AM and 5 PM local time, which corresponds to 2 AM to 10 AM in Eastern Standard Time. Attractions and Activities in Maun

Maun is known as the gateway to the Okavango Delta, one of the world’s largest inland deltas and a UNESCO World Heritage site. The region’s unique ecosystem supports a wide variety of wildlife, making it a prime destination for eco-tourism and safaris. Visitors to Maun often embark on guided tours to explore the Delta’s intricate waterways, lush vegetation, and abundant animal species, including elephants, hippos, and numerous bird species.

Culturally, Maun is home to the Bakalanga people, and local traditions can be experienced through various festivals and community events. The town itself has a growing arts scene, with local crafts and markets showcasing traditional handicrafts. Additionally, the nearby Moremi Game Reserve offers opportunities for wildlife viewing and photography, enhancing Maun’s significance as a hub for adventure and nature enthusiasts.

Overall, Maun serves as a crucial point for exploring the natural wonders of Botswana while also reflecting the rich cultural heritage of its inhabitants.

Practical Information for Visitors

Maun is served by Maun Airport, which provides domestic flights from major cities in Botswana and some international connections. While there is no train service directly to Maun, long-distance buses operate from Gaborone and other regions, making it a viable option for budget travelers. Consider renting a vehicle if you plan to explore the surrounding areas, especially the Okavango Delta.

The climate in Maun is characterized by a semi-arid environment, with hot summers and mild winters. Summer months, from November to March, can see temperatures soar above 35 degrees Celsius during the day, with occasional rainfall. The best time to visit is during the dry season, from April to October, which is ideal for wildlife viewing.

When visiting Maun, it’s advisable to stay hydrated and wear sunscreen due to the intense sun. Carry cash, as not all places accept credit cards, and familiarize yourself with local customs and wildlife safety guidelines. Engaging with local guides can enhance your experience, providing insight into the unique ecosystems of the Okavango Delta and surrounding areas.
